getAverageVolume
▸ getAverageVolume(buffer): number
Utility function to get the average volume from getByteFrequencyData
Remarks
This is a better option when you only need to get the volume in terms of performance and complexity.
Parameters
| Name | Type |
|---|---|
buffer | Float32Array |
Returns
number
getByteFrequencyData
▸ getByteFrequencyData(buffer): void
Copies the current frequency data into a Uint8Array (unsigned byte array) passed into it.
The frequency data is composed of integers on a scale from 0 to 255.
Remarks
The bytes versions are not cheaper than the float version but provided for convenient: the byte version are computed from the float version, using simple quantization to 2^8 values ref. https://padenot.github.io/web-audio-perf/#analysernode
Parameters
| Name | Type | Description |
|---|---|---|
buffer | Uint8Array | Use provided buffer instead of creating a new one |
Returns
void
getByteTimeDomainData
▸ getByteTimeDomainData(buffer): void
Copies the current waveform, or time-domain, data into a Uint8Array (unsigned byte array) passed into it.
If the array has fewer elements than the AnalyserNode.fftSize, excess
elements are dropped.
If it has more elements than needed, excess elements are ignored.
Remarks
The bytes versions are not cheaper than the float version but provided for convenient: the byte version are computed from the float version, using simple quantization to 2^8 values ref. https://padenot.github.io/web-audio-perf/#analysernode
Parameters
| Name | Type | Description |
|---|---|---|
buffer | Uint8Array | Use provided buffer instead of creating a new one |
Returns
void
getFloatFrequencyData
▸ getFloatFrequencyData(buffer): void
Copies the current waveform, or time-domain, data into Float32Array passed into it
Remarks
The buffer size should be the same as AnalyserNode.frequencyBinCount
Parameters
| Name | Type | Description |
|---|---|---|
buffer | Float32Array | Use provided buffer instead of creating a new one |
Returns
void
getFloatTimeDomainData
▸ getFloatTimeDomainData(buffer): void
Copies the current waveform, or time-domain, data into Float32Array passed into it
Remarks
The buffer size should be the same as AnalyserNode.fftSize
Parameters
| Name | Type | Description |
|---|---|---|
buffer | Float32Array | Use provided buffer instead of creating a new one |
Returns
void
